Hi can anyone explain please how I can take a screen shot please.

You need to have a word document open -- then find the screen you want and push print screen -- nothing will appear to happen -- go back to the word document and press paste and trust -- the screen shot magically seems to appear!

you can also print screen button go into accesories go down to paint open that up and paste into there this will allow you to edit it and crop it etc.

If you have Windows 7 it comes with a Snippet tool so you can capture just the part you want.

One thing I've noticed is that screen size and therefore number of pixels affects the resolution of the image that is saved! On my laptop, the resolution is not good, but if I use the computers at work (which have a very high resolution as they are for diagnostic purposes), the image quality is greatly increased!
